    “I believe social media is one of the most important marketing tools to emerge since the creation of the World Wide Web.”

    ~ Fred Joyal’s Blog

    “No online social networking personally or professionally anymore. Most of it is a waste of time. I’d rather spend the valuable time with my wife and kids who have also decided not to do any of the online social networking anymore.”

    ~ The Wealthy Dentist Blog

    Ohio Prosthodontist

    “With social media growing at an unprecedented rate and a large percentage of our patients participating on these popular channels daily, the decision to establish our own space on these social networks was easy. Now our practice can easily distribute office news, dental information and practice promotions to our entire network of patients with the click of a mouse. Not to mention that our patients can always join in on the conversation by providing feedback.”

    ~Latest Breaking News
